ORDER
The recommended disposition submitted by United States Magistrate Judge Patricia
S. Harris has been reviewed. No objections have been filed. After careful consideration, the
recommended disposition is hereby adopted in all respects. Walter Curtis Moles’s petition
for writ of habeas corpus pursuant to 28 U.S.C. § 2241 is dismissed without prejudice.
IT IS SO ORDERED this 26th day of August 2016.
